5.2. – And the record is....
The most Tony Awards ever received by a single production was the musical The Producers, with 12 awards.

Read a book that has a 1 and/or a 2 in its series number. Examples, 1, 2, 12, 22. No other numbers may be included in the series number. The series name and number must be indicated in the GR title listing, in grayscale parentheses following the title.
